Open lectures at Doncaster College

SHAKESPEARE will be the subject of the first of a series of open lectures at Doncaster College due to start in April.

Dr Monika Smialkowska, the Advanced Studies Curriculum Leader at the college, will be giving the inaugural free lecture at The Stables, High Melton, on Tuesday April 15 at 6.30pm.

Dr Smialkowska's lecture, Toil and Trouble: Shakespeare and the American Melting Pot, will be the first of many after the college launched its own forum last month.

The lecture is free and refreshments will be available.

More details about other lectures will be announced in the coming weeks.
